 Hi,

 I want to create a activity that receives intents modify these and
 send them to an other activity that is also registerd to receive this
 kind of intents. These two activities are not in the same package. Is
 there a way to specify a activity that should receive this intent?

 I am new to android and I know that it would be bad and ugly to do
 something like this but it is only a proof of concept.

Hi Lutz,
When we talk of sending intents from Activity1 to Activity2 ,
Activity2 should have the intent filter
with the intent with which it wants to be invoked.
After getting invoked from activity1 , activity2 can further invoke
another activity with intent
data it wants.
You can also use broacastreceivers to get such kind of functonality.
Note: Receivers are invoked only by a broadcast call!
